Abstract
We highlight the use of a tyrosine kinase inhibitor, pazopanib, for neoadjuvant downstaging a 7.4 cm right biopsy-proven clear cell renal-cell carcinoma in a solitary kidney before surgical intervention of robotic partial nephrectomy with retrograde cooling to induce cold ischemia in a 79-year-old male.Entities:

Pretreatment axial-contrasted CT scan of the abdomen and pelvis demonstrating right renal mass. Coronal view of 7.4 cm right upper pole renal-cell carcinoma extending caudally involving >50% of solitary kidney.

Post-treatment axial-contrasted abdominal CT scan demonstrating reduction in the right renal mass by 25%. Coronal view post-treatment of tyrosine kinase inhibitor. Regression of tumor away from the renal vein.
